Los Angeles California Order to Seal Juvenile Records is a legal process that allows individuals to have their juvenile criminal records removed from public view. By sealing these records, the court renders them inaccessible to the public and restricts their disclosure to only limited authorized parties. The order to seal juvenile records in Los Angeles California applies to various types of cases, including but not limited to: 1. Juvenile Arrest Records: This includes records of arrests or detentions of individuals under the age of 18. These records may contain information regarding the nature of the offense, date of arrest, and other related details. 2. Juvenile Court Records: These records pertain to cases that have proceeded to court and may include documents such as petitions, court orders, probation reports, and hearing transcripts. 3. Juvenile Conviction Records: When a minor is found guilty of an offense, their conviction record is created. This record typically details the charges, plea entered, disposition, and any associated sentences or probation terms. To obtain an Order to Seal Juvenile Records in Los Angeles California, certain criteria must be met. These criteria may include the following: 1. Age requirement: The petitioner must have reached the age of majority, usually 18 years old or older. 2. Completion of sentence: The individual must have successfully completed all court-ordered sanctions, including probation, community service, counseling, or restitution. 3. Waiting period: There is typically a waiting period that varies depending on the offense committed, ranging from one to five years, during which the petitioner must stay out of any criminal trouble. 4. Rehabilitation: The court will consider the petitioner's behavior, efforts at rehabilitation, education, employment history, and any contributions made to society since the offense. 5. Eligible offenses: Not all offenses are eligible for sealing. Certain serious crimes, such as violent offenses, sex offenses, or offenses committed after the age of 26, may not qualify for record sealing. Once the criteria are met, the individual or their legal representative can file a Petition to Seal Juvenile Records in the Los Angeles County Juvenile Court. It is highly recommended seeking legal counsel to navigate the complex process and ensure all necessary documentation is prepared accurately. The court will conduct a hearing to determine whether the records should be sealed, weighing the petitioner's rehabilitation efforts against the potential harm or benefit to the public. By obtaining an Order to Seal Juvenile Records in Los Angeles California, individuals can significantly mitigate the negative impact of past mistakes, preventing these records from potentially affecting their future educational, employment, or housing opportunities.

Generally, a juvenile crime will stay on your record until successful completion of probation, with exceptions for serious crimes which cannot be sealed until the age of 18 (or 21 if you were committed to the Department of Youth and Community Restoration).

In California, juvenile criminal records are sealed and inaccessible by the general public according to California Rule of Court 5.552, and Welfare and Institution Code section 827.

If you are a party to a defamation civil lawsuit, your juvenile record may be opened and admissible as evidence during the proceedings. Once the lawsuit is resolved, the records will once again be sealed.

To have your juvenile records sealed, you need to complete and file a petition in the county court where your juvenile conviction or proceedings were held. The process of sealing your juvenile record will take about eight to ten months to complete.

HOWEVER, when you get your juvenile record sealed in California, it's as if it never existed. So, if you got your juvenile record sealed, you do not need to disclose anything in it.
